What Are the Signs You Need in Boiler Repair in Bethesda, MD?

There are many signs that can indicate you might be in need of boiler inspection or repair. When you notice them, it’s important to act fast to ensure that your boiler does not become more damaged as a result. Some of the signs that you might need to give Prime Plumbing a call for boiler repair in Bethesda, MD include:

  1. No heat
  2. No pilot light
  3. Yellow or irregular flame (instead of blue)
  4. Poor water pressure or a sudden drop in water pressure
  5. Strange sounds or odors coming from the boiler
  6. Smoke marks on the walls surrounding the boiler
  7. Cold or lukewarm radiators
  8. Needing to adjust the thermostat constantly to maintain the right temperature
  9. High energy bills compared to past stretches with similar highs and lows
  10. Long delays between when your boiler kicks on and when your home actually starts to heat
  11. Needing frequent repair or needing to make the same repair multiple times
  12. Condensation or other visible moisture present around the body or base of the boiler
